CryptoCompare states that 'Tellor' is a decentralized Oracle system, where miners compete for data points in an on-chain database. The system uses native tokens called "Tributes" (TRB) as incentives to encourage miners to submit information through base rewards and tips for each query. To validate data updates, miners must provide proof of work solutions. A TRB deposit is required as a stake or bond. TRB can also be used to govern valid data via disputes, and system upgrades that are proposed by token holders and voted upon. TRB supply is determined by the amount of tokens used and the mining rate. 50% of each block's tips are given to miners, and 50% are burned.
